Charges on two spheres are +10μC and −5μC respectively. They experience a force F. If each of them is given an additional charge +2μC then new force between them keeping the same distance is
When there is no additional charge F=R2K(+10)(−5) F=R2−50K...(i)
when +2μC charge is added to both spheres.
Charge on 1st sphere =10μC+2μC=12μC
Charge on 2nd sphere =−5μC+2μC=−3μC
New force will be F′=R2K(+12)(−3)=−R236K...(ii)
From (i) and (ii) ∴FF′=−R236K×−50KR2 =5036 ⇒FF=2518
